Understanding Automation Levels: Semi-Automatic Explained

Automation level is one of the most critical configuration decisions for industrial equipment manufacturers. The market offers three primary tiers: Manual, Semi-Automatic, and Fully Automatic. Each serves distinct buyer segments with different cost structures, operational requirements, and ROI timelines.

According to Mordor Intelligence's Industrial Machinery Market Size & Share Analysis, semi-automated/CNC systems held 45.68% market share in 2025, making it the dominant segment. This dominance is not accidental—semi-automatic equipment strikes an optimal balance between capital expenditure and operational flexibility that aligns with SME budget constraints worldwide [1].

Market Share by Automation Level (2025): Semi-automated/CNC 45.68% (dominant), Manual 37.6%, Fully-automated robotic cells 16.72% (fastest growth at 9.59% CAGR). Industrial machinery market valued at USD 0.87 trillion in 2026, projected to reach USD 1.31 trillion by 2031 (CAGR 8.34%) [1].

For small to medium enterprises selling on Alibaba.com international marketplace, semi-automatic configuration offers several practical advantages:

Lower Capital Investment: Semi-automatic equipment typically requires 40-60% less upfront investment compared to fully automatic systems. This makes it accessible to buyers in emerging markets (Southeast Asia, Africa, Latin America) who are scaling operations but face financing constraints.

Human Oversight for Quality Control: Unlike fully automatic systems, semi-automatic equipment retains human intervention at critical checkpoints. This is particularly valuable for customized orders, small batch production, and applications requiring visual inspection—common scenarios in B2B trade.

Faster Payback Period: Industry analysis indicates semi-automatic systems achieve ROI in 2-3 years versus 5-7 years for full automation. For SME buyers operating on thin margins, this difference determines whether a purchase decision is financially viable [1].

Asia-Pacific region accounts for 40.56% of industrial machinery market share with 9.81% CAGR, driven by manufacturing expansion in China, India, Vietnam, and Indonesia. Semi-automatic equipment dominates this region due to labor cost advantages and flexibility requirements [1].

Warranty Standards: What 1-Year Coverage Really Means

Warranty period is often the most misunderstood attribute in B2B equipment procurement. While consumers may assume longer warranty equals better quality, B2B buyers understand that warranty terms reflect a complex balance between manufacturer confidence, risk allocation, and service infrastructure.

The 1-year warranty configuration represents the industry standard baseline for industrial equipment. According to Fortune Business Insights, the global Warranty Management System market is projected to grow from USD 7.38 billion in 2026 to USD 22.28 billion by 2034 (CAGR 14.81%), reflecting increasing sophistication in after-sales service delivery [2].

What does 1-year warranty typically cover for semi-automatic industrial equipment?

✅ Included: Manufacturing defects in materials and workmanship, electrical component failures (motors, controllers, sensors), structural integrity issues (welding, framing), software bugs in control systems. ❌ Excluded: Normal wear and tear (brushes, belts, filters), operator error or misuse, unauthorized modifications, consumables, damage from improper installation or environmental conditions.

Configuration Comparison: Making the Right Choice

There is no universally optimal configuration—only the configuration that best matches your target buyer profile, production capacity, and competitive positioning. The following comparison table provides a neutral analysis across common automation and warranty combinations:

Automation Level & Warranty Configuration Comparison

ConfigurationTarget BuyerPrice PositionROI TimelineBest ForKey Risks
Manual + 6 months warrantyMicro enterprises, startups, price-sensitive marketsLowest1-2 yearsEntry-level markets, developing regions, low-volume productionLimited differentiation, high labor dependency
Semi-Auto + 1 year warrantySMEs, established workshops, balanced budget-qualityMid-range2-3 yearsMost versatile, broadest market appeal, customization-friendlyModerate competition, requires quality documentation
Semi-Auto + 2 years warrantyQuality-conscious buyers, regulated industriesMid-high2-3 yearsEuropean markets, medical/food applications, brand-buildingHigher warranty cost, requires service infrastructure
Fully Auto + 1 year warrantyHigh-volume manufacturers, cost-per-unit focusedHigh5-7 yearsLarge factories, consistent high-volume productionHigh capex, longer payback, limited flexibility
Fully Auto + 2+ years warrantyEnterprise buyers, critical applicationsPremium5-7 yearsAutomotive, aerospace, mission-critical operationsHighest risk exposure, requires global service network
Comparison based on industry analysis and buyer feedback. Actual performance varies by product category, target market, and supplier capabilities.

Semi-Automatic + 1 Year Warranty emerges as the most versatile configuration for Southeast Asian exporters for several reasons:

Market Coverage: This configuration appeals to the broadest buyer segment—from emerging market SMEs to established workshops in developed countries. The 1-year warranty meets baseline expectations without imposing excessive service burden on new exporters.

Competitive Positioning: With 45.68% market share, semi-automatic is the mainstream choice. Offering standard 1-year warranty positions you as a credible supplier without overcommitting resources before establishing market presence [1].

Scalability: As your business grows on Alibaba.com, you can introduce higher-tier configurations (2-year warranty, fully automatic options) without alienating your initial customer base. Starting with the mainstream configuration reduces market entry risk.

However, this configuration is NOT ideal for:

Premium brand positioning: If you're targeting luxury or mission-critical applications, 1-year warranty may signal insufficient confidence. • Highly regulated industries: Medical, food processing, or aerospace applications often require extended warranty and certification. • Price-war commodity markets: If competing solely on price, manual + 6 months may be necessary (though not recommended for sustainable growth).
